Without looking at it too closely, you can probably add a container div or something that wraps all your code up, and then assign a min-width
attribute to ensure that it never goes smaller than the given size.
Your layout seems to be relying on the width of your body
and as your window size changes so will the width of your body. Having a wrapper with a min-width
or declared width
will make it so a horizontal scroll bar will appear when users have a window smaller than the width of your container.
And like others have stated, you have some nesting issues. General page layout will look like this:
<html>
<head>
<!-- Head Content -->
</head>
<body>
<!-- Page Content -->
<ul>
<li><!-- List Item --></li>
<li><!-- List Item --></li>
</ul>
</body>
</html>
